Solved Windows 8 won't shut down.

Up until today, I haven't been able to shut down, restart, or put to sleep my computer. Usually when I close the laptop and open it back up, it locks it self, but this time it can't even do that.
I've already tried executing tasks in the task manager, turning off the fast start-up, but nothing seems to work.
I've looked around for other options but I don't really understand them much, I am not good with computer stuff :\

hi, right click on the lower left corner to bring up the start icon ,right click on it ,choose power options near the top of the list ,go in there and setup a power plan.
then ,to shut off the computer ,mouse over the lower right corner to open the charms bar ,click on the settings icon ,then the power icon on the bottom
